A good samaritan came to the rescue after he stumbled upon a porch engulfed in flames while in the Gosling Meadows neighborhood of Portsmouth on Thursday.

Ed Brown was working a few houses down when he noticed a fire spreading at a nearby residence. Brown owns Spots For Lots, which is a seal coating and crack repair business. He happened to be in the Gosling Meadows neighborhood when he saw the flames.

Brown said he immediately went to his truck where he keeps a fire extinguisher. When he got to the house, part of the porch was already on fire and both the eaves and awning were catching fie as well.

Brown said he was able to get about 90% of the fire out. While he was doing that, some other neighbors came out and Brown had them knock on the apartment doors to make sure everyone was out.

He also knocked on the apartment that occupied the right side of the house and had those tenants exit through the back.

Brown says the Portsmouth Fire Department arrived quickly, although he said that in those circumstances even five minutes felt more like an hour. He added that the holiday decorations on the porch were burned, as well as some of the railing and part of the roof.
